16 gigs of RAM... 2x8 or 4x4?
The question is in the title. I'm looking at DDR3 1333 (PC3 10666) RAM. Is it faster or of any benefit to have two sticks of eight, or four sticks of four?
-
Lesser Hivemind Node
Depends on your motherboard. If your motherboard supports quad channel memory, you want 4x4. If it supports dual channel it's less important; given equal pricing I'd probably go for 2x8 since the risk of a bad DIMM is lower.
